    I use a HyperX Cloud 2 Gaming Headset for audio calls and voice communication on my PC. Recently I upgraded my Operating System to Windows 10, from Windows 7 and my friends in Discord/Audio calls have told me that my voice through the microphone sounds absolutely horrible and scratchy now as opposed to when I had Windows 7 installed and it was crystal clear.

    I've gone through the full driver installation process for new OS installs and cleared everything. Fidgeted with audio preferences in Windows 10, Discord settings etc as much as I could. Certain sites recommended disabling Audio enhancements through the Audio preferences in Windows and that did nothing. Unfortunately i have no "convenient" way of demonstrating what it sounds like but it I'm at my wits end on this I've uninstalled, and reinstalled several different versions of compatible Realtek drivers, audio drivers, and reinstalling the Hyper X drivers, nothing is fixing this quality issue.

    Kingston Announces the HyperX Cloud Stinger Gaming Headset

    HyperX, a division of Kingston Technology Company, Inc., the independent world leader in memory products, solidifies its commitment to creating quality gaming gear for everyone with the release of the HyperX Cloud Stinger gaming headset. Designed to make even the most casual gamer feel like a pro, the HyperX Cloud Stinger features HyperX signature memory foam and 50mm directional drivers to deliver a comfortable, high-quality sound experience at an affordable price.

    HyperX Cloud Stinger weighs just 275 grams and is built with 90-degree rotating ear cups to provide hours of comfort for console and PC gaming. The lightweight headset includes 50 mm directional drivers that are tilted to position sound directly into the ear, resulting in a broader and more accurate in-game sound. HyperX Cloud Stinger also offers a convenient set of features for gameplay, including a swivel to mute the microphone, an adjustable steel slider for long lasting durability, and volume controls on the headset.

    Additional HyperX Cloud Stinger Specifications:

    Headphones
    • Driver: Dynamic, 50 mm with neodymium magnets
    • Type: Circumaural; closed back
    • Frequency response: 18Hz-23,000Hz
    • Impedance: 30 Ω
    • Sound pressure level: 102 ± 3dBSPL/mW at 1kHz
    • T.H.D: ≦ 2%
    • Input power: Rated 30mW, Maximum 500mW
    • Weight: 275g
    • Cable length and type: Headset (1.3m) + Extension Y-cable(1.7m)
    • Connection: Headset - 3.5mm plug (4 pole) + extension cable - 3.5mm stereo and mic plugs
    Microphone
    • Element: Electret condenser microphone
    • Polar pattern: Uni-directional, Noise-canceling
    • Frequency response: 50Hz~18,000Hz
    • Sensitivity: -40 dBV (0dB=1V/Pa,1kHz)

    Windows 10 update for HyperX Cloud II Gaming Headset

    I made an account just to describe my similar situation. It could possibly apply to some of you who haven't gotten your mic to work yet:

    • I bought a HyperX Cloud headset (the one without the soundcard).
    • After two months the microphone randomly stopped working after not being used for a week. Headset played sound normally.
    • Tested and checked a lot of things - turned out the microphone worked fine, but the cord coming from the headset to the dongle was the problem.
    • Reported the product as defective to my local store and they confirmed my suspicion and replaced the device.

    But it's not where it ends.

    • I now have HyperX Cloud 2 with the soundcard after trading headsets with my boyfriend.
    • In the SAME EXACT fashion the microphone stopped working again on a completely different headset.
    • Tested it again and it's THE SAME ISSUE. The cord coming from the headset is defective, mic is actually fine.
    • I emailed the manufacturer and they said to mail them the device, which I'll be doing in the next few days. (update: Kingston replaced the headset and sent me a new one)

    I'm certain that this is a type of manufacturing error because this is absurd. I take good care of my equipment and have never experienced things randomly dying on me like this.

    So if you haven't yet found a solution, consider testing the microphone on its own (after checking if it isn't muted or disabled) by plugging it straight into the jack on your computer, try it on different machines and if you have a friend with the same
    headset, change the mic and test everything with theirs as well.

    EDIT:

    For reference I've always used Win 8.1 and my boyfriend was on 8.1 and Windows 10. I had these issues, he never did.
